The number of barrels of oil reserves has increased from 193 million to 238 million.

With the help of the Special Investment Facilitation Council, the Energy Sector has advanced. New energy project discoveries and local investment have been made possible by SIFC’s facilitation.

Oil and gas reserves have increased significantly for the first time since 2020.

Oil reserves have grown from 193 million barrels to 238 million barrels, according to a research by Arif Habib.

New initiatives to alleviate persistent energy shortages and lessen reliance on imports are supported by this increase in reserves. Enhancing domestic energy supplies is a crucial component of the nation’s long-term energy security plan.

The SIFC’s ongoing assistance has been crucial in facilitating these advancements and has enabled the growth of oil and gas reserves.
